Lenovo has announced the Yoga A12: a 2-in-1 laptop with a keyboard without physical buttons. The laptop thus resembles the Yoga Book, only the A12 runs Android, it does not come with a stylus and it has a larger screen.

The Lenovo Yoga A12 has a 12.1″ screen, where the Yoga Book has a 10.1″ screen. Lenovo has not yet announced the resolution of the A12: the company is talking about an unspecified ‘HD’ screen. Inside the case is an Intel Atom x5 soc, along with 2GB of ram and 32GB of storage. That’s half the amount the company uses with the Yoga Book.

Where the Yoga Book comes with both Windows and Android, the A12 will only be available with Android. The flat touch-sensitive keyboard, which Lenovo calls Halo, is present, which does not have physical buttons but does provide haptic feedback.

This keyboard can be flipped 360 degrees to use the laptop in tablet mode. According to the manufacturer, the battery life of the device is around 13 hours, although it is not known in which scenario this was measured. The Yoga A12 will be available in gray and pink for $299. Converted and with VAT, that is 336 euros.
